CrackStation importance in Network system

  CrackStation uses massive pre-computed lookup tables to crack password hashes. These tables store a mapping between the hash of a password, and the correct password for that hash. The hash values are indexed so that it is possible to quickly search the database for a given hash.  If the hash is present in the database, the password can be recovered in a fraction of a second. This only works for "unsalted" hashes. For information on password hashing systems that are not vulnerable to pre-computed lookup tables, see our hashing security page. Crackstation's lookup tables were created by extracting every word from the Wikipedia databases and adding with every password list we could find. We also applied intelligent word mangling (brute force hybrid) to our wordlists to make them much more effective. What is the purpose of a Windows Workgroup?

 Windows for Workgroups is an extension that allowed users to share their resources and to request those of others without a centralized authentication server. It used the SMB protocol over NetBIOS. The Microsoft Windows family of operating systems supports assigning of computers to named workgroups. Macintosh networks offer a similiar capability through the use of AppleTalk zones. The Open Source software package Samba allows Unix and Linux systems to join existing Windows workgroups. Workgroups are designed for small LANs in homes, schools, and small businesses. A Windows Workgroup, for example, functions best with 15 or fewer computers. As the number of computers in a workgroup grows, workgroup LANs eventually become too difficult to administer and should be replaced with alternative solutions like domains or other client/server approaches. network portion in IPv4 Subnetting

  During the early stages of the internet, organizations assigned IP addresses like crazy until we nearly ran out. Luckily, the designers of IP addressing came up with a way to end this wasteful practice: Dividing networks using subnetting. The process of taking an extensive network and splitting into smaller networks is known as subnetting — and it’s freeing up more public IPv4 addresses. There are two parts to an IP address: The network portion and the host portion. It’s like the address for a house. The network portion is like the city, state, and zip code. The host portion is like the house and street number. A subnet defines the number of bits, out of 32, used for the “network portion” of the address. Subnet masks can also be defined in a more common ‘slash’ representation, known as CIDR notation. In the following table, the red digits represent the bits used for the network. Disable Your Windows 7 PC

  The change goes live with Windows 7 KB4530734 Monthly Rollup. Microsoft has included a new version of the EOSnotify.exe program to the update package that will now display an with a full screen notification explaining why users should upgrade to Windows 10. All Windows 7 Service Pack 1 Starter, Home Basic, Home Premium, and Professional editions will the following full-screen alert when they login or at 12 PM. The text says Your Windows 7 PC is out of support As of January 14, 2020, support for Windows 7 has come to an end. Your PC is more vulnerable to viruses and malware due to: No security updates No software updates No tech support Microsoft strongly recommends using Windows 10 on a new PC for latest security features and protection against malicious software. network adapter role in Networking

  The network adapter is a card or built-in port on your computer’s motherboard that allows you to connect your computer to a network with a network cable. Like other hardware devices in your computer, the network adapter may require you to install updated drivers for better performance. You can download these drivers from the network adapter’s manufacturer website. Depending on the format of the driver, you may be able to automatically install the update or you may need to update through your computer’s device manager.
